Cover Picture: MRI image of the horizontal plane across 18-week-old human formalin-fixed fetal brain illustrates the capacity of this method to expose details and measure size of the major telencephalic structures during the course of prenatal development. Cresyl violet stained histological section on the left and AChE histochemistry on the right provide comparison and verification of the details essential for delineation of differential growth.
